Primary Diagnostic Examinations in Pulmonology
Pulmonology relies on various diagnostic tests to examine lung feature and detect respiratory system problems. These examinations aid pulmonologists collect vital details concerning a patient's lung wellness, guaranteeing precise diagnoses and reliable treatment strategies.
Lung Function Tests (PFTs)
Pulmonary Feature Examinations measure exactly how well the lungs function. They assess lung quantity, ability, and circulation prices via a number of different methods, including spirometry. Throughout spirometry, the client infuses a tool that videotapes exhaled air and computes key metrics such as forced essential ability (FVC) and forced expiratory volume (FEV1).
PFTs help identify obstructive and restrictive lung illness, such as bronchial asthma,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D), and lung fibrosis. The tests are easy, non-invasive, and generally carried out in a controlled setting, enabling consistent results that pulmonologists can translate accurately.
Upper body X-Ray
A breast X-ray is a typical imaging examination that enables pulmonologists to see the frameworks within the breast. It highlights the lungs, heart, ribs, and capillary, allowing the discovery of abnormalities such as infections, lumps, or fluid accumulation.
The treatment is quick and includes direct exposure to low degrees of radiation. While a breast X-ray provides preliminary insights, it may not be sufficient for a conclusive medical diagnosis. Thus, more testing might be required to make clear searchings for.
Computed Tomography (CT) Check
A Computed Tomography (CT) Check offers a lot more detailed pictures of the lungs than a standard X-ray. By incorporating multiple X-ray photos drawn from various angles, CT scans develop cross-sectional photos of lung frameworks.
This diagnostic device is crucial for identifying conditions such as lung lumps, lung blemishes, and complicated infections. Furthermore, a CT check can assist evaluate the intensity of lung conditions and overview therapy approaches. Clients might require to lie still for several minutes while the scan is being carried out, which can be testing for some individuals.
Bronchoscopy
Bronchoscopy includes utilizing a thin tube with an electronic camera, called a bronchoscope, to visualize the respiratory tracts and lungs. This treatment allows pulmonologists to directly analyze the bronchial tubes and accumulate cells examples or mucous for additional analysis.
Bronchoscopy is specifically useful for detecting infections, lumps, or other lung abnormalities. It can additionally assist in interventions like removing blockages or draining liquid. Although it needs sedation, it is typically risk-free and provides critical details regarding lung wellness that can not be acquired through other methods.
Advanced Diagnostic Procedures
Advanced analysis treatments play a critical function in identifying complex lung problems. These tests supply comprehensive images and info about lung function, helping pulmonologists in making exact assessments.
Positron Exhaust Tomography (PET) Check
A Positron Exhaust Tomography (ANIMAL) check is an innovative imaging technique made use of to review metabolic task in the lungs. During this procedure, a patient obtains a percentage of radioactive sugar. This enables the scan to highlight locations of high metabolic activity, typically indicative of cancer cells or other abnormalities.
The details gathered from a pet dog check is valuable in distinguishing between benign and malignant sores. It likewise assists in hosting lung cancer cells and monitoring therapy reaction. The mix of pet dog with CT checks offers comprehensive understandings, making it possible for pulmonologists to create customized treatment strategies based on precise findings.
Ventilation/Perfusion (V/Q) Scan
The Ventilation/Perfusion (V/Q) check analyzes the air flow and blood flow to the lungs. This test is necessary for diagnosing problems like pulmonary embolism. The procedure involves 2 components: an air flow scan, which uses a radioactive gas or aerosol to review how well air gets to the lungs, and a perfusion check, which takes a look at blood circulation using a radioactive tracer.
Outcomes are translated via imaging that highlights inconsistencies in between ventilation and perfusion. Substantial mismatches might suggest problems such as obstructions in the lung arteries. This check aids pulmonologists in identifying the root cause of respiratory system symptoms and guiding suitable interventions.
Analyzing Examination Outcomes
Analyzing examination outcomes is important in evaluating lung health and wellness. It includes comparing typical and irregular searchings for while understanding just how these outcomes guide therapy choices.
Understanding Regular vs. Irregular Outcomes
Normal examination outcomes suggest that lung feature is within expected varieties. Each test produces particular metrics, such as lung capacity, airflow price, and oxygen levels. Common criteria differ by age, sex, and ethnic culture, so pulmonologists consider these variables.
Unusual outcomes might expose problems like obstructive or limiting lung disease. As an example, a reduced FEV1/FVC proportion can suggest obstructive conditions like bronchial asthma or COPD. It is essential for doctor to realize these differences, as they straight influence the person's management plan.
